The NCLUSD Special Board Meeting held on December 11, 2025, focused primarily on the presentation and discussion of the 2025-26 first interim financial report. The report detailed enrollment trends, average daily attendance (ADA), and funding projections under the Local Control Funding Formula (LCFF). Key procurement-related topics included budget adjustments reflecting changes in state and federal revenues, including discretionary block grants and behavioral health initiative grants. The board discussed the need to address a projected deficit spending of approximately $4.9 million for the current year and considered potential budget cuts of $2 to $3 million to restore reserve levels and ensure fiscal stability in subsequent years. Salary step and column increases, as well as the impact of one-time funds and grants on the budget, were also reviewed. The board approved the first interim report and directed staff to continue refining budget assumptions for future presentations, emphasizing the importance of conservative financial planning and maintaining adequate reserves.
